Black Horse
Black Horse operates as a shipping and freight forwarding company with a history dating back to 1997. Based in Alexandria, Egypt, the company emphasizes a professional team of specialists focused on clearance and transportation processes. The organization positions itself as a partner for global cooperation, aiming to collaborate with freight forwarders around the world to facilitate international shipments and cross-border movements.
As a freight forwarder serving the Egyptian market and its international trading partners, Black Horse highlights its expertise in customs clearance as a core competency.
